Etymology 1
Inherited from Latin rōmānus. Compare Daco-Romanian român (c-o form in older times rumân "both were used"), Istro-Romanian rumăr. The initial a- is a common phonological development in Aromanian words deriving from Latin words beginning with r-.
Noun
armãn m (feminine armãnã, masculine plural armãnj, feminine plural armãni or armãne, definite singular armãnlu, definite feminine singular armãna, definite plural armãnjlji, definite feminine plural armãnili)
- Aromanian (a person of Aromanian descent)

Etymology 2
From Latin remaneō. Compare Daco-Romanian rămâne, rămân.
Verb
armãn first-singular present indicative (third-person singular present indicative armãni or armãne, past participle armasã)
- to stay, remain
